Directly observing behavior encompasses four methods. This includes outcome recording, event recording, interval recording, and time sample recording. The outcome recording method applies in uniform behaviors where one expects unique results. Observers can use this easy-to-use method at their own convenience. This is because one checks on the results rather than the observable behavior. Outcome recording can also apply in recording complex behavior. The drawback of this method is that it cannot observe emotions or feelings expressed by people. Consequently, one has to be sure the outcome is unique for the method to apply.
